#3f5557 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3f5557 is composed of 24.7% red, 33.3% green and 34.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 27.6% cyan, 2.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 65.9% black. It has a hue angle of 185 degrees, a saturation of 16% and a lightness of 29.4%. #3f5557 color hex could be obtained by blending #7eaaae with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

● #3f5557 color description : Very dark grayish cyan.
#3f5557 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3f5557 has RGB values of R:63, G:85, B:87 and CMYK values of C:0.28, M:0.02, Y:0, K:0.66. Its decimal value is 4150615.

Shades and Tints of #3f5557
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050707 is the darkest color, while #fbfcf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#3f5557
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4b4b4b is the less saturated color, while #058591 is the most saturated one.
